Separating Routine Complaints from a Switching Pattern

A single network outage or a capacity rejection does not make a switching lead. The difference is the combination of evidence types appearing together in the same exchange. In this composite situation, the technical team mentions high-density rack limits being hit repeatedly, cross-border network instability affecting production traffic, the upcoming renewal date, and concrete migration logistics — all within the same discussion. Capacity impact, network SLA shortfalls, renewal timing, and migration actions appearing together elevate the discussion beyond a typical support escalation. For a business-development lead at an IDC & technical export provider, this cluster of signals is what separates a routine service complaint from a potential qualified opportunity worth following.

Three Signals That Shift the Discussion from Complaints to Evaluation

First, the team references power density limits that prevent them from deploying additional equipment. A capacity ceiling complaint, when paired with a specific renewal date, signals that the team is not just venting — they are timing their options. Second, they compare network SLAs between their current provider and unnamed alternatives, citing specific performance metrics that suggest they have already requested competitive proposals. Third, they ask about IP portability: whether existing address blocks can move to a new facility. These three signals — capacity frustration, competitive SLA comparison, and portability inquiry — together indicate the team is actively evaluating alternatives rather than merely reporting problems that a support ticket might resolve.

The Unknowns That Keep This from Being a Confirmed Lead

Even with strong signals, several critical unknowns prevent this from being treated as a verified switching opportunity. Failure ownership is unclear: the team attributes network instability to the current provider, but cross-border performance issues can originate from upstream carriers, undersea cable congestion common in Southeast Asian markets, or the team’s own routing configuration. Migration inventory — which specific racks, power circuits, and network links would need to move — has not been stated in the discussion. Real capacity at any alternative facility the team references remains unverified; a provider that advertises higher density may not deliver the required power-per-rack in practice. IP portability between facilities in different regulatory jurisdictions is also uncertain and can affect migration timelines. Until these unknowns are investigated, the discussion remains a indicator, not a confirmation.

What to Verify Before Engaging Directly

Before a business-development lead at an IDC & technical export provider treats this discussion as a qualified lead and contacts the party, four items need verification. First, identify who owns each failure: which incidents fall on the current colocation provider versus the carrier or the tenant’s own equipment. Second, document the full migration scope — number of affected racks, total power draw, cross-border network link requirements, and any IP address blocks that must move. Third, validate real capacity at any facility the team mentioned during the evaluation: published density figures and actual available power may differ significantly. Fourth, confirm the exact renewal date and whether a notice period or automatic renewal clause applies. Without these facts, the indicator remains at the interest stage, and premature contact risks damaging credibility.

Timing the Engagement Around the Renewal Window

The month before contract renewal is the natural decision window. If the team has already compared SLAs and asked about migration logistics, they are likely in the evaluation phase. A timely approach from a provider that can present verified capacity and IP portability options has a natural opening. However, the correct sequence is to verify the signals, confirm the unknowns, then engage with specific capacity and migration answers that match what the team has already asked about in the group. A business-development lead at an IDC & technical export provider who completes the verification steps before reaching out can present themselves as informed and prepared — a significant advantage when the team is comparing alternatives within a narrowing time frame.
